After months of research and product development, Chr Hansen will launch ‘L. casei 431 Juice’, a probiotic developed to survive in low pH environments such as chilled juice and juice drinks.
“L. casei 431 Juice contains Lactobacillus paracasei 431,” said Marie Brenoee, global marketing manager, probiotic cultures, Chr Hansen. “This probiotic strain has very strong scientific documentation as well as a long history of use in yogurt and dietary supplement products. With a survival of eight weeks, thus securing long shelf life for the beverage product, L. casei 431 Juice outperforms competitive products in the marketplace. Further, it has no side effects, such as unpleasant off-flavour or gas formation. We simply consider the strain the probiotic juice category’s ‘proof of concept’.”
To tackle traditional production risks associated with adding live probiotic bacteria to juice after pasteurisation (risks such as moulds, yeasts and cross contamination of the juice plant), Chr Hansen teamed up with Tetra Pak.
The two companies have developed a unique inoculation system that guarantees safe production of probiotic juice.
